Arrest in fatal shooting in Waterbury, Vermont – NECN

Vermont State Police have arrested a man in connection with a fatal shooting at a Waterbury home earlier this week.

20-year-old Fabrice Rumama of Springfield, Massachusetts, was arrested and charged with second-degree murder.

Vermont State Police said they were called to a home in the Kneeland Flats Trailer Park around 12:45 a.m. Monday and found the victims. The deceased was identified as Shawn Spiker, 34, of Croydon, New Hampshire. The chief medical examiner’s office said he died of multiple gunshot wounds and ruled the death a homicide.

A second man suffered serious injuries and was taken to the University of Vermont Medical Center in Burlington, where he remains in critical condition. He was identified as a resident of Barre City.

Police said the two men were acquaintances and that Spiker had been in Vermont for a short time.

Rumama is being held without bail and is expected in Vermont Superior Court in Barre on Monday.
